Sr. Staff SW QA Engineer
Description
- Lead QA efforts across multiple product lines and releases
- Design and execute QA test plans and test cases based on product requirements
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ams including development, product management, and automation
- Drive quality initiatives and ensure alignment with business goals
- Identify, document, and manage software defects using bug tracking systems
- Participate in requirement reviews and provide QA feedback
- Ensure comprehensive test coverage and traceability for all functional requirements
- Mentor and guide junior QA engineers in testing practices and tools
- Represent QA in project planning and review meetings
- Communicate effectively with stakeholders on test progress, risks, and mitigation plans
- Lead functional QA activities within the team and provide strategic input on test planning
- Foster a culture of ownership, accountability, and continuous learning within the QA team
- 11+ years of hands-on experience in functional QA testing
- Proven experience in leading QA efforts and mentoring team members
- Strong understanding of QA methodologies and software development lifecycle
- Strong understanding of data traffic payload
- Experience with test case management tools (e.g., TestRail, Mercury Center)
- Experience on traffic generation tool (Xena , Spirent , Ixia ..)
- Familiarity with bug tracking systems (e.g., Jira, Bugzilla)
- Solid understanding of networking protocols (TCP/IP, L2/L3, L4–L7)
- Scripting knowledge (Python, Perl, TCL, Expect) is an advantage
- Excellent analytical, troubleshooting, and communication skills
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or related field
